The interview process was very unprofessional and I got a cult-like vibe the entire time.
The process length was reasonable. I had a phone screener or two and then was assigned a case study and given a week to complete it. I was told that my in person interview would be one hour and I would present the case study to a group of people. This was NOT the case.
Only after I arrived and after I was taken on a tour of the facility did I learn that the interview length was 3 hours, not 1. I wasn't told this, rather I saw a piece of printer paper with the interview time written on it taped to the door of the room in which I was being interviewed. I had to make last second changes to childcare to accommodate Fisher's lack of communication.
I went through two rounds of interviews regarding skills that were NOT LISTED ON THE JOB POSTING...which I was woefully unprepared for. While I had experience in these areas in the past, I would have needed some refresher before interviewing and I was given no indication that I would be questioned on them.
In the third and final part of the interview I went through another series of questioning. At the end (and what seemed like an afterthought) I was allotted 10 minutes to give the presentation I spent a week working on. The interviewers didn't even seem interested in paying attention.
Fisher requires 5 10 hour days a week and offers very low pay. Employees are required to adhere to a formal business dress code even though the roles are not client facing.
My overall impression is that this is a cult-like company that's trying to pretend they're in the big leagues. They prey on young professionals who are directly out of college and have no idea what a healthy work environment is supposed to look like.
I chose not to continue the interview process any further.
